Understanding the Unique Requirements of Computer Science Students (H1)

The realm of computer science necessitates distinctive prerequisites when it comes to laptops. These students demand a machine capable of handling resource-intensive tasks, such as programming, data analysis, and simulations. Furthermore, the need for portability is paramount as students move between lectures, libraries, and collaborative workspaces.

Key Factors for Deliberation (H2)

1. Performance (H3)

Performance is of the essence for computer science students. A laptop should house a potent processor and abundant RAM to ensure seamless multitasking and efficient coding. Laptops powered by Intel Core i5 or i7 processors, along with a minimum of 8GB RAM, are advisable for optimal results.

2. Choice of Operating System (H3)

The selection of an operating system frequently boils down to personal preference. Nevertheless, many computer science students tend to gravitate towards laptops running Unix-based systems such as Linux or macOS. This inclination is attributed to the compatibility of these systems with programming tools and software development environments.

3. Portability (H3)

Portability holds utmost significance for students who are invariably on the move. Laptops that are both lightweight and equipped with enduring battery life are ideal for those who need to transition swiftly between classrooms, libraries, and study nooks.

4. Graphics Capability (H3)

While a dedicated graphics card may not be a top priority for most computer science tasks, it can certainly be advantageous for endeavors such as machine learning and data visualization.

5. Storage (H3)

Swift and capacious storage is imperative for housing substantial datasets and accommodating software installations. Opting for laptops that feature solid-state drives (SSDs) is recommended due to their rapid performance and dependability.

Top Recommendations for Laptops Tailored to Computer Science Students (H2)

1. MacBook Air (H3)

The MacBook Air reigns supreme as a preferred choice among computer science students who favor macOS. It boasts an elegant design, commendable battery life, and potent performance. The M1 chip, in particular, has garnered commendation for its efficiency.

2. Dell XPS 13 (H3)

For those inclined towards Windows, the Dell XPS 13 emerges as a standout choice. It presents a compact design, a vibrant display, and remarkable processing power, rendering it apt for coding and a gamut of other computing tasks.

3. Lenovo ThinkPad X1 Carbon (H3)

The ThinkPad series is celebrated for its durability and an exceptional keyboard, rendering it a preferred choice among programmers. The X1 Carbon marries portability with robust performance.

4. ASUS ROG Zephyrus G14 (H3)

Should you require a laptop that straddles both coding and gaming, the ASUS ROG Zephyrus G14 offers a compelling proposition. It features a formidable AMD Ryzen processor and an NVIDIA GPU, catering to the needs of both gamers and programmers.

5. Google Pixelbook (H3)

For those who harbor a preference for ChromeOS, the Google Pixelbook seamlessly amalgamates simplicity and functionality. It emerges as an ideal choice for web-based coding and research tasks.

Tailoring Your Choice to Fit Your Budget (H2)

1. Budget-Friendly Alternatives (H3)

Should you find yourself adhering to a strict budget, consider laptops such as the Acer Aspire or HP Pavilion. These options provide decent performance at a price point that is accessible to most students.

2. Mid-Range Laptop Options (H3)

Laptops like the HP Spectre or the ASUS VivoBook strike an equilibrium between performance and cost. They are well-suited for everyday computing tasks and coding assignments.

3. Premium Laptops for Discerning Users (H3)

For those who can allocate a more substantial budget, premium options like the MacBook Pro or the Dell XPS 15 stand as beacons of top-tier performance and impeccable build quality. These laptops are an ideal choice for demanding tasks and professional utilization.
